Dictionary Habib Anthony Salmone, An Advanced Learner's Arabic-English Dictionary (1889)

Entry زكو

زَكَا(n. ac. زَكَآء [] زُكُوّ [] ) زَكِيَ(n. ac. زَكًى [] زَكَاة [] ) a. Grew, throve; increased. b. Was upright, just; was pure. زَكَّوَa. Made to grow, thrive; increased. b. Purified ; declared pure. c. Paid the poor-rate on ( his property ). d. Collected the poor-rate of. أَزْكَوَa. see I (a) & II (a). تَزَكَّوَa. Was good, pious &c.; purified himself; gave the poor-rate, gave alms. زَكًاa. Even; even number; pair. زَكَاة [] (pl. زَكَو زَكَوَات ) a. Purity; purification. b. Poorrate, legal alms. زَكِيّ [] (pl. أَزْكِيَآء [] ) a. Pure, spotless; pious, good; righteous; upright honest, virtuous. b. [ coll. ], Intelligent. زَكِيَّة [] a. Rich, excellent (soil).
